Recently the Garden City Tornadoes enjoyed a glorious victory over the Merrick Starzz. They couldn't have done it without their fantastic coaches: Gerry Oakes, assisted by Buddy Gardner, Charlie Piscopo and Mike Hartigan.

Tornadoes enjoy a well-deserved treat after their win.

Early in the game an enthusiastic Carrie Long scored the first goal, assisted by her friend and teammate, Katie Gardner. Katie Rose, Kara Kelly, Amanda LeSueur, Claire Hartigan, Krista Tenaglia and Mary Clare Oakes displayed their tremendous talents in the defense department. They all played together, protected the goal and supported the forward lines.

Nicole Diller astonished the crowd with two breakaways and showed excellent passing and dribbling skills. Three-quarters through the first half the Merrick Starzz scored n unstoppable goal, tying the score 1-1.

In the last few moments of the first half, Ann Kemen came to the rescue by scoring a beautiful goal, assisted by Long, giving the Tornadoes the lead once more.

During the second half, Montse Caccamo was all over the field acting as the team's secret weapon, while Krystie Piscopo was making effective plays and assuring the ball would stay in the offensive zone.

Ann Kemen scored her second goal of the day assisted by Katie Gardner, her second assist.

Brigid Moore and Amanda Russo played a very aggressive game, which contributed to the Tornadoes spunk.

Janie Burke and Janine Lind made fantastic plays as forwards, keeping the ball in the opponents end of the field.

The team's goalies, Nicole Perrotta and Kara Kelly, on whom the Tornadoes depend so much, stayed calm and collected during exciting play in their end.

The final score was 3-1, Garden City Tornadoes. A very talented team enjoyed a much deserved win.
